The National Park Service (NPS) is pleased to announce the release of two commemorative centennial badges. These special designs were created with the help of NPS employees, and NPS retirees are invited to share in the excitement of the centennial by purchasing these badges.

The Centennial Arrowhead Badge takes the official NPS emblem as its inspiration and adds several elements to celebrate 2016 as the centennial year. Retirees may purchase a wearable version of the badge ($39.99) or a version encased in high-quality Lucite ($109.99).

The Centennial Law Enforcement badge modifies the current law enforcement badge in several ways to highlight the centennial. Additionally, the DOI/bison seal is replaced with an NPS/eagle seal as a nod to the history of NPS badges, which featured an eagle from 1905 to 1968. Retirees may only purchase a version of the LE badge encased in high-quality Lucite ($112.00).
